Low-Interest Loans Available For Drought Hit Farmers
UNDATED—The U.. Department of Agriculture is offering help to Indiana farmers whose crops were damaged by drought conditions last summer.
Twenty-four counties have been designated as primary natural disaster areas, and farmers can apply for low-interest emergency loansthrough the Federal Farm Service Agency.
Counties locally that are eligible include, Crawford, Jackson, Orange, and Washington.
Twenty-five other counties may also be eligible for federal aid, locally they are Brown, Dubois, Lawrence, Martin adn Monroe.
